E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
resultMap
[笔记] MyBatis-Plus XML 配置详解:从基础到高级,全面提升开发效率
update标签4.delete标签二.动态SQL标签1.if标签2.choose-when-otherwise标签3.where标签4.set标签5.trim标签6.foreach标签三.高级映射1.
resultMap
鲁子狄
·
2025-06-18 04:51
笔记
#
java
#
sql
笔记
mybatis
xml
java
sql
mysql
数据库
MyBatis实战指南(五)结果映射
二、结果映射的类型与使用场景1.基础映射:自动映射的三种方式1.1列名与属性名完全一致:纯自动映射1.2列名与属性名不一致:SQL别名适配1.3列名与属性名复杂映射:
resultMap
显式配置(推荐方案
珹洺
·
2025-06-12 05:34
#
MyBatis实战指南
mybatis
sql
数据库
java
2.1MyBatis——ORM对象关系映射
2.1MyBatis——ORM对象关系映射1.验证映射配置2.ResultType和
ResultMap
2.1
ResultMap
是最终的ORM依据2.2ResultType和
ResultMap
的使用区别3
wyy546792341
·
2025-06-01 09:27
Java开源框架学习
mybatis
java
ibatis使用报错:Check the result mapping for the ‘xxx‘ property,quoted string not properly terminated
在使用ibatis的时候报这个错误,挺常见,一般我们就会去检查SQL查询的字段和
resultMap
是否对应。可是这次经过我仔细的检查之后,发现写的都是对的。只好采用排除法来检查错误。
xrz277
·
2025-05-20 23:03
后端
java
乱码
ibatis
property
spark:map 和 flatMap 的区别(Scala)
1.用map的效果代码示例scalavalresultMap=rdd.map(sentence=>sentence.split(""))
resultMap
.collect()输出结果scalaArray
WZMeiei
·
2025-05-16 01:30
Spark
spark
大数据
分布式
scala
mybatis多表查询报java.lang.IllegalArgumentException: argument type mismatch
最近两天在搞多表查询:我觉得要注意一下几点1:确定哪张表为主表2:在主表中添加对象类型的属性,并且确定是一对一还是一对多3:在mapper.xml中使用
ResultMap
的方式进行字段的整合
zengqinggen
·
2025-05-15 07:55
mybatis
mybatis
多表查询
mybatis多表查询的结果映射(
resultMap
)
Mybait多张表查询时的结果映射
resultMap
1、mybatis简介MyBatis是一款优秀的持久层框架,它支持自定义SQL、存储过程以及高级映射。
小鸡费斯特
·
2025-05-15 07:24
mybatis
java
mysql
SpringBoot中 Mybatis 的xml映射文件配置
目录1.依赖2.示例代码2.1不带
resultMap
标签示例2.1带
resultMap
标签示例3.
resultMap
标签不加的情况说明1.依赖在pom.xml文件中引入依赖org.mybatis.spring.bootmybatis-spring-boot-starter-test3.0.3test2
灵眸幻翎
·
2025-05-13 21:35
mybatis
xml
java
spring
boot
MyBatis 一对多关联映射在Spring Boot中的XML配置
基本概念一对多关系指的是一个实体对象包含多个子对象集合的情况,例如:一个部门有多个员工一个订单有多个订单项一个博客有多个评论实现方式1.使用嵌套结果映射(
ResultMap
)SELECTd.idasdept_id
Main12138
·
2025-05-13 20:02
持久层
mybatis
spring
boot
xml
使用mybatis实例类和MySQL表的字段不一致怎么办
以下是几种常见解决方案及代码示例:1.使用
resultMap
显式映射(推荐)场景:字段名与属性名差异较大,需自定义映射规则实现步骤:在XML映射文件中定义
resultMap
通过column指定数据库字段
昔我往昔
·
2025-05-04 02:25
面试题
数据库
mybatis
java
面试
MyBatis的XML语法的常用用法
MyBatis的XML语法的常用用法MyBatis的XML语法的常用用法mysql数据库一、数据库层面二、增加相关三、修改和删除相关四、查询相关4.1不使用
resultMap
4.2使用
resultMap
1
l1o3v1e4ding
·
2025-04-29 19:50
java
sql
数据库
面试中被问到mybatis与jdbc有什么区别怎么办
细节代码量需要手动编写大量样板代码(连接、异常处理等)通过配置和映射减少冗余代码SQL管理SQL嵌入Java代码,维护困难SQL与Java代码分离(XML/注解),便于维护结果集映射手动遍历ResultSet,转换为对象自动映射(
ResultMap
云之兕
·
2025-04-29 09:05
java程序员成长之路
面试
mybatis
spring
Mybatis的
resultMap
标签介绍
说明:在Mybatis中,
resultMap
标签可以用于SQL查询后的封装数据,本文用两个场景介绍
resultMap
标签的使用。
何中应
·
2025-03-30 20:00
mybatis
mybatis
后端
java
<
resultMap
>详解
详解在MyBatis的中,标签用于处理一对一的关联映射,也就是一个实体对象关联另一个实体对象的情况。下面为你详细解释标签里各个属性的含义:1.property1.property作用:该属性指定了当前实体类中用于关联另一个实体对象的属性名。在这个例子里,property="partner"意味着在当前的实体类(可能是NodeVo)中有一个名为partner的属性,它的类型是Partner类,用于存
兰德里的折磨550
·
2025-03-29 21:29
tomcat
java
mybatis
Mapper.xml中的resultType与parameterType与
resultMap
resultType在MyBatis中,resultType是一个在、、、这类SQL映射标签中使用的属性,它指定了SQL查询返回结果应该被映射成的Java类型。该Java类型可以是一个简单的基础数据类型(例如Integer、String等),也可以是一个复杂的JavaBean对象,通常用于封装多个属性的值。目的是让MyBatis知道如何将SQL查询得到的数据行转换成Java对象。MyBatis会根
suimeng6
·
2025-03-29 11:19
xml
mybatis
mysql
mysql中mapping标签的作用_Mybatis中Mapper标签总结大全
一、标签分类定义SQL语句insertdeleteupdateselect配置关联关系collectionassociation配置java对象属性与查询结果集中列名的对应关系
resultMap
控制动态
文清的男友
·
2025-03-27 05:18
每日学习Java之一万个为什么
Mybatis分步查询如果有下一步查询计划,resultType需要改为
resultMap
,(只要这张表的查询大于1就用Map)并在Map中配置下一步计划在本计划中的实体类,查询列名,下一步计划方法路径
~Yogi
·
2025-03-18 13:02
修炼
学习
java
mybatis
使用MyBatis返回数据为null
解决办法:在XML映射文件中使用
resultMap
将数据库属性名与实体类属性名映射:使用
resultMap
表明返回类型:select*fromuser_info;
测试开发小白变怪兽
·
2025-03-18 08:21
服务端
由 Mybatis 源码畅谈软件设计(五):
ResultMap
的循环引用
本节我们来了解Mybatis是如何处理
ResultMap
的循环引用,它的解决方案非常值得在软件设计中参考。另外作为引申,大家可以了解一下Spring是如何解决Bean的循环注入的。
方圆想当图灵
·
2025-03-11 13:34
由
Mybatis
源码畅谈软件设计
mybatis
代码规范
'2.587426955E9' in column '2' is outside valid range for the datatype INTEGER.
原因:因为这里是使用mybatis做的,这个sql的
resultMap
的返回值是一个实体类于是想到了与该实体类中该属性的类型有关果然,它原来的类型是int修改为
fan510988896
·
2025-02-26 16:42
JAVA
2.587426955E9
in
col
Mybatis-Mapper配置
resultMap
–描述如何从数据库结果集中加载对象,是最复杂也是最强大的元素。parameterMap–老式风格的参数映射。此元素已被废弃,并可能在将来被移除!请使用行内参数映射。
zl979899
·
2025-02-24 13:12
SSM
java
mybatis
Mybatis源码05 - Mapper映射文件的配置
Mapper映射文件的配置文章目录Mapper映射文件的配置一:更新的配置和使用1:模板mapper2:实例说明二:select、
resultMap
的配置及使用1:select的配置2:实例说明3:
resultMap
4
是小崔啊
·
2025-02-14 01:45
#
mybatis源码
mybatis
数据库
java
源码
MyBatis学习:多表映射
MyBatis使用
ResultMap
实现
Landy_Jay
·
2025-02-03 13:17
mybatis
学习
数据库
关于在学习mybatis框架中遇到的xml解析错误的bug
:org.xml.sax.SAXParseException;lineNumber:136;columnNumber:10;元素类型为"mapper"的内容必须匹配"(cache-ref|cache|
resultMap
愿天堂没有java
·
2025-01-30 10:14
java学习
mybatis
学习
xml
最新面试题【mybatis】
第二种使用
resultmap
进行一一对应3,动态SQL执行原理,有哪些?
牛马baby
·
2025-01-21 19:27
1024程序员节
java
IDEA 中编写 MyBatis 的 XML 文件,parameterType 无法跳转到类 Cannot find declaration to go to.
出现上图的问题,
resultMap
标签中的type和parmeterType中的类报红且无法跳转到对应的类中,此问题可能有几个原因:1.没有配置别名2.没有写全路径解决方法:alias配置别名(具体可以看其他文章的配置
_Max_Ma
·
2025-01-16 17:09
MyBatis
intellij-idea
mybatis
xml
带你直击小程序毕设答辩现场(三)
同学可回答:1、@
ResultMap
注解引用已经定义好的结果映射。2、@Options注解可以获取到自增主键的值问题八答辩老师:还有SpringBoot框架的常用注解。
计算机毕设定制辅导-无忧学长
·
2024-09-12 13:48
小程序
课程设计
spring和Mybatis的各种查询
查询单个数据6.4、查询一条数据为Map集合6.5、查询多条数据为Map集合七、**特殊SQL的执行**7.1、模糊查询7.2、批量删除7.3、动态设置表名7.4、添加功能获取自增的主键八、**自定义映射
resultMap
eqa11
·
2024-09-07 14:56
spring
mybatis
java
mybatis中parameterType,resultType和
resultMap
的区别
在MyBatis中,parameterType、resultType和
resultMap
是与SQL语句和映射器接口方法相关的三个重要属性。
会有黎明吗
·
2024-09-04 20:43
mybatis
java
sql
mysql
数据库
mybatis中的
resultMap
,超详细讲解
resultMap
元素是MyBatis中最重要最强大的元素。
resultMap
的设计思想是,对简单的语句做到零配置,对于复杂一点的语句,只需
cijiancao
·
2024-08-31 16:44
数据库
07|第七课:输出参数为各种类型以及HashMap和
resultMap
的使用
一、历史回顾(一)、输出参数ResultType1、简单类型(8个基本类型+String)例:基本类型int2、对象类型(或者是对象的集合类型)例:对象类型(也可以是List等集合类型)
resultMap
木头amo
·
2024-08-31 15:06
Java-MyBatis 框架之延迟加载、缓存和分页
第一节:性能优化1.1延迟加载1.1.1什么是延迟加载
resultMap
中的association和collection标签具有延迟加载的功能。
【小红帽】
·
2024-08-23 20:52
MyBatis面试简答题
描述MyBatis中的
ResultMap
的作用,并说明如何定义和使用它。MyBatis如何处理数据库中的null值?请解释M
糯米小麻花啊
·
2024-03-26 06:52
mybatis
resultmap
中collection每次只能查询到一条数据
1、原因如果两表联查,主表和明细表的主键都是id的话,明细表的多条只能查询出来第一条。2、解决办法级联查询的时候,主表和从表有一样的字段名的时候,在mysql上命令查询是没问题的。但在mybatis中主从表需要为相同字段名设置别名。设置了别名就OK了。例子:主表Standard,从表StandEntity,均有名为id的字段(依据下面的select中更名的字段id别名se_id,在此将相同的字段名
小喳喳进阶
·
2024-03-02 22:43
mybatis
Mybatis
collection
一条记录
MyBatis--08--常用标签
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录1.常用属性2.SQL定义标签2.1select2.2insert2.3update2.4delete2.5
resultMap
2.6sql3
知行合一。。。
·
2024-02-19 20:13
Spring基础知识--SSM
mybatis
java
开发语言
3.Mybatis 注解方式的基本用法
3.2使用注解实现复杂关系映射开发实现复杂关系映射之前我们可以在映射文件中通过配置来实现,但通过后我们发现并没有@
ResultMap
这个注解。我们可以使用@Re
半夏_2021
·
2024-02-14 17:51
mybatis
从入门到精通
mybatis
MyBatis关联关系映射详解
在MyBatis中,我们可以通过
resultMap
来实现一对一的映射。首先,
·
2024-02-14 03:32
你知道 Mybatis 框架如何实现级联关系吗?
级联关系实现的方式一对一一对多案例实操一对一关系实现方式resultType/
resultMap
接口方法一对一关联查询resultType@paramuserId@returnUserDtoqueryUserCardInfoForResultType
天上的小仙女呀
·
2024-02-13 15:49
mybatis mapper.xml中
resultMap
配置带有自定义类做成员变量的类;mapper.xml引用另一个mapper.xml中的内容
mapper.xml中
resultMap
配置带有自定义类做成员变量的类前情提要:每一个person对应一张会员卡(card)/*card类*/@Data@NoArgsConstructor@AllArgsConstructor
航行在夜空
·
2024-02-12 05:59
数据库
后端
mybatis
java
【Mybatis】从0学习Mybatis(2)
第一期在这儿:【Mybatis】从0学习Mybatis(1)-CSDN博客1.什么是
ResultMap
结果映射?
ResultMap
是一种用于定义查询结果映射规则的配置方式。
qq_54432917
·
2024-02-06 10:15
Mybatis
数据库
java
servlet
oracle
mybatis
学习
mybatis---高级映射、延迟加载、查询缓存
高级映射(
resultMap
返回)首先书写查询语句select*fromuser,orderswhereuser.id=orders.user_id其次配置
resultMap
什么是延迟加载
resultMap
全满
·
2024-02-06 08:54
mybatis缓存-延迟加载
设置延迟加载什么是延迟加载
resultMap
可实现高级映射(使用association、collection实现一对一及一对多映射),association、collection具备延迟加载功能。
Auroral746
·
2024-02-06 06:22
mybatis
java
数据库
mybatis
mybatis 用
resultMap
和用实体vo返回有啥区别?
mybatis用
resultMap
和用实体vo返回有啥区别?
日日行不惧千万里
·
2024-02-05 17:52
Java学习
mybatis
数据库
oracle
【无标题】
1.springboot中
resultMap
作用?2.type的作用是?定义
resultmap
和Java中的哪个pojo对象进行映射3.查询计划执行日志的代码分析?
Programmer boy
·
2024-02-04 15:33
java
spring
boot
mybatis
mybatis调用存储过程
调用存储过程MyBatis调用存储过程的方式,和普通的select查询方式用法相同,都可以接收方法入参(parameterType=String|Object|Map)、和方法返回值(resultType|
resultMap
ihaveadream丶
·
2024-02-04 11:49
日常小记
mybatis
java
mysql
MyBatis<select>节点中的resultType和
resultMap
属性
1.为什么要进行resultType或
resultMap
注解配置当需要实现的数据访问是查询类型的,在节点中必须配置resultType或
resultMap
中的某1个属性(二选一),如果都没有指定,则会出现如下错误
_江屿_
·
2024-02-03 10:01
MyBatis
mybatis
关联查询的详细理解与实现
我用#CSDN#这个app发现了有技术含量的博客,小伙伴们求同去《Mybatis通过
ResultMap
实现关联查询》,一起来围观吧https://blog.csdn.net/qq_30130355/article
20d5675a164c
·
2024-02-02 17:21
MyBatis映射文件
delete、update、insert、sql(include)缓存:cache、cache-ref参数映射:parameterMap(该标签已被废除,关于参数的映射可以使用行内参数映射)解决映射:
resultMap
1
碧海暮苍梧
·
2024-02-02 08:59
MyBatis
java
mybatis
mybatis
resultMap
映射详解
是Maybatis的结果集封装,搭配等标签的
resultMap
属性使用属性:id:该封装规则的唯一标识type:封装出来的类型,可以是jdk自带的,比如Map,应该可以是自定义的,比如EmployeeautoMapping
hollow_0120
·
2024-02-02 08:57
mybatis
mybatis查询结果集的映射关系
mybatis没有开启驼峰规则,那么数据库的列名和实体类的属性名需要一模一样,实体类属性加@Column没有作用select*fromt_userwhereuser_name=#{username}使用
resultMap
你是理想
·
2024-02-02 03:55
mybatis
mybatis
java
数据库
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他